THOMAS GIRTIN

(1775-1802)

Deer in the Windsor Forest

Deer in the Windsor Forest
Pencil and watercolour on paper
19 x 16 cm
Acquired by The Metropolitan Museum of Art, New York

Provenance

Major-General Arthur K. Hay DSO OBE

The Estate of Mr Joseph B. Hay

Literature

To be included in Greg Smith’s upcoming catalogue raisonneé on the artist

This on-the-spot watercolour which has only recently surfaced, shows Windsor Forest, the great expanse (5000 acres) of parkland that surrounds the castle. This remarkably sensitive watercolour calls to mind the opening lines of Alexander Pope’s poem Windsor Forest:

 

 

Thy forests, Windsor! and thy green retreats,

At once the Monarch's and the Muse's seats,

Invite my lays. Be present, sylvan maids!

Unlock your springs, and open all your shades.
